The New 'Three R's' - Revamp, Reorganize & Recreate
   By Gisele Dickson of the Consignment Gallery

       The signs of Fall are all around us; days are shorter, nights a little on the chilly side, and the kids have gone back to school. Now, after an extremely busy summer, it’s finally your time to relax a little and think about what needs to be done around the house to make it especially cozy.

    Whether you have just moved or are rearranging, you will certainly want to include within your decor that ‘precious treasure’; that one item that some call a ‘white elephant’, but to you it still holds a special place in your heart.

    While it may be challenging to work around this piece, it is also exciting. Today’s decorating possibilities are endless, limited only by your imagination. We’ve outgrown the lifestyles of our parents. Back then, everything matched and some rooms were so formal that only guests could enter.

    Following are the new three R’s to adding your personal touch to your decorating endeavours:

    Revamping... your treasure may require a simple cleaning or a complete overhaul. If major work is required, you will need the help of an expert. Experience, talent and communication are essential; remember to get some references. Also keep an open mind to new possibilities. For example, an old chair may be perfect as a plant stand or an easel.

    Reorganizing... is a matter of cleaning out and eliminating. This process, though time consuming and sometimes emotionally painful, needs to be done before you can move forward. If possible, move all items out of the room, then bring back only those that will work in your new decor. Box up everything else. Check these items at a later date and if they still won’t work in your home, give them away or sell them either privately or through consignment.

    Recreating... is the fun part. Let your imagination run wild. Just think, your once Victorian room could become a Hemingway hideout. Fall is the ideal time to introduce warm and sensuous accessories. An area rug, afghan, ottoman, candles and a stack of must read books all contribute to a cozy, inviting atmosphere.

    Thankfully for the young at heart, there is a wealth of unique, one-of-a-kind establishments that provide a treasure trove of goodies.

    Antique shops are a wonderful find for anyone searching for lost pieces. These items usually come with quite a history and allow us to revisit our childhood. Remember that old trunk Great Grandmother had? It’s out there somewhere just waiting for you.

    Furniture consignment stores offer a unique experience because they receive stock on a daily basis. It is consignment, so expect the unusual. Consignment offers a wide range of styles from antique to contemporary, all in ‘like new’ condition. Be prepared to make your purchase as consignment pieces generally move very quickly and you wouldn’t want to be disappointed. Consignment stores are also a great place to explore new decorating possibilities; displays change often so you will want to visit regularly. Lastly, they are a great way of selling items that you no longer require.

    Specialty boutiques are perfect for finding those wonderful pieces that pull a room together. They usually offer expertise in one theme or area. Because of the nature of the business, their buyers (often the owners) will purchase items with their customers in mind, so let them know what you are looking for.

    Creativity and patience are essential ingredients when decorating from the heart and the rewards are incredible. Relax and enjoy the adventure! After all, your home is your haven.
